What are the video formats of the Xiaomi TV Q2 50''?

The Xiaomi TV Q2 50'' supports many video formats, providing you with a better video experience.
For your reference, here are details about the video formats supported by the Xiaomi TV Q2 50'':
1. Dolby Vision IQ dynamically adjusts the HDR content based on ambient lighting, providing optimized picture quality in any viewing condition;
2. HDR10 enhances brightness and color range for a more vivid picture, while HLG (Hybrid Log-Gamma) is specifically designed for live broadcast content;
3. AV1 is designed to provide high-quality video compression at lower bit rates compared to previous codecs like H.265 (HEVC) and VP9;
4. H.263 is an older codec used primarily for low-bitrate video, such as video conferencing;
5. H.264 (AVC) is a widely used codec offering good video quality and compression efficiency, in HD video streaming and Blu-ray discs;
6. H.265 (HEVC) is an advanced codec that provides even better compression efficiency than H.264, allowing for higher quality video at lower bit rates, used for 4K and high-definition video;
7. VP8 is designed to be a high-quality, open-source alternative to H.264;
8. VP9 is an improvement over VP8, VP9 offers better compression efficiency and is designed to handle higher resolutions, like 4K video;
9. MPEG-1 was designed for low-bitrate digital audio and video, like on CDs and early digital video. MPEG-2 improves upon MPEG-1, offering higher quality, and is widely used for DVDs, digital TV, and some streaming services;
10. MJPEG (Motion JPEG) is a video compression format that uses a series of independent JPEG images to create a video sequence. Each frame is a complete JPEG still image, and when played back, these frames are displayed in succession to form motion.
